A Plumber Can Check the Supply Lines


A supply line, especially a dishwasher connector, links the dish washer to a water resource. A plumber can ensure that the line is suitable with both your dishwasher and also water resource if you acquire a brand-new supply line. A specialist plumber can examine it to ensure that it's in excellent problem and does not have any leakages if you choose to utilize an existing supply line.

Installing a Dishwasher Needs a Selection of Tools


If you do not have a selection of tools on hand, you may need to make a trip to Lowe's or Home Depot. To mount a dishwasher, you need the following tools: pliers, an adjustable wrench, a set of screwdrivers, a tube cutter, and hole saws.

Not Installing Your Dish Washer Correctly Can Cause a Mountain of Issues


Not only can mounting a dish washer properly void your warranty, yet it can also create a mess. For instance, if you do not install the supply line properly, you could handle leaks-- or even worse, a flooding. You could likewise experience a "water hammer"-- when the water runs as well quickly via your pipelines as well as causes loud drinking noises. If you incorrectly install your dishwasher to the trash disposal, you might notice pungent smells or have deposit on your recipes.

SINK AND DISHWASHER INSTALLATION


If you want to relocate the sink and dishwasher, major plumbing work needs to be done. The sink needs an access point to both hot and cold water, which connects from the faucets and a waste-pipe. Your dishwasher calls for the same type of plumbing work. The water supply and waste-pipe access are extended from the sink to the dishwasher, which is why these two appliances need to be placed next to each other.


If you're simply looking to have a new sink installed in the same location, less professional work needs to be done, meaning your bill will be significantly cheaper. When shopping for a new sink, consider upgrading to features like extensions, sprayers, soap dispensers and a stainless steel garbage disposal.
